What is the main newspaper in Cuba?
Granma
Granma is the official newspaper of the Central Committee of the Cuban Communist Party….Granma (newspaper)

What is CiberCuba?
Based in Spain, online newspaper CiberCuba was founded in November 2014 by Cuban expatriates Luis Mazorra and Luis Flores. A small group of writers and editors works from their central offices in Valencia but staff is radicated on the island, Miami, Mexico, Argentina, etc.
How many newspapers are there in Cuba?
Besides three national newspapers, the country knows a range of regional newspapers such as the Tribuna de la Habana as well as a bi-weekly on culture and art: Bohemia.

Who owns CiberCuba?
Luis Flores and Luis Mazorra are two Cuban entrepreneurs, based in Spain. Back in November 2014, they decided to re-vamp and old news aggregate site called CiberCuba.
Who owns the media in Cuba?
The Cuban media are tightly controlled by the Cuban government led by the Communist Party of Cuba (PCC) in the past five decades. The PCC strictly censors news, information and commentary, and restricts dissemination of foreign publications to tourist hotels.
